Ticket: Config drift in Haulwise driver-assignment heuristic. During the quarterly audit we found the proximity-weighting parameters on the Kelmford cluster diverge from the approved baseline, likely from a manual hotfix last sprint. This matters for the security review because the drifted weights bypass the fairness cap we certified. Please compare against the values below before approving remediation. The current live configuration is as follows.

deployment values, yadug-bawif:
[framir]
team = pelox
access_code = ac_a38ab2
owner = tamion.julael
host = framir.tolvaqlabs.test
port = 11211
peer = tammir.zemvargrid.local
salt = 2215ef03
pin = 1541

## Authentication

QuotaHawk enforces per-tenant rate quotas, so before you poke at a customer's limits, make sure you're hitting the right tenant slug — otherwise you'll be staring at someone else's numbers. Support folks get read-only access by default, which covers the usual "why am I throttled" tickets. Requests without credentials bounce with a 401, no exceptions. For the shared support environment, authenticate with the key below.

service key, fawip-bajef: kto11_Qt5wZK9vdNC

GC pauses in Pairline's matching service deserve careful attention. Pauses above 200ms cause match requests to queue, and queued requests older than one second are silently dropped by the Verrick gateway. Before restarting a node, capture a heap dump and note the pause distribution from the last hour. The full diagnostic procedure, including safe restart ordering, is documented on the page below.

runbook for baguf-bawip: https://jira.qorvelsys.internal/pages/pages/pages/browse/1853

TICKET-4412: SDK parity gap — batch upload missing in Kotlin client

The Swift SDK for Larkspur Sync supports batchUpload() since v2.3; the Kotlin SDK silently drops all but the first item.

Repro:
1. Init Kotlin client against staging.
2. Call upload() with a list of 3 records.
3. Query the records endpoint — only one record persists.

Expected: all three records stored. To reproduce against staging you must authenticate; use the token below.

session JWT of tadup-kaguf = eyJhbGciOiJIUzI1NiIsInR5cCI6IkpXVCJ9.eyJzdWIiOiItNz4V3In0.KrZCeqpk